Service Manager for Joint Commissioning
We are pleased to advertise this opportunity for the role of Service Manager for Joint Commissioning in the Adults Commissioning Team at Bradford Council.
The post holder will share responsibility for commissioning a ranges of services for people with Learning Disabilities, Mental Health needs, Autism and Neurodiversity and for our Early Help and Prevention and Homelessness services.
The post holder will work 18.5 hours per week. We can offer some flexibility over when these hours are worked, but they must include some time on Tuesdays and Fridays. Hybrid working arrangements are in place allowing working from home and the office.
You will be joining a supportive and highly skilled People Commissioning Service which champions Bradford's commissioning and contract management practice and functions as key driver for service change and integration within the wider health and care partnership.
Significant experience of managing complex and high value strategic commissioning activities is essential, along with a comprehensive understanding and experience in strategic planning, the cycle of commissioning and ability to rapidly review policy, evidence and data to define need.
Successful candidates will demonstrate a detailed understanding of the legislative and working practices related to Adult Social Care, and of the principles of strengths-based practice and approaches that prevent and delay the need for care.
